Jacquemus x Nike Moon Shoe Campaign Debuts as Online Release Set for Sept. 29

The reworked 1972 design showcases Nike heritage via ruched nylon with a Regrind sole.

  • Nicholas Alexander Chavez fronts the campaign shot by Oliver Hadlee Pearch, with imagery in a dance studio and outdoor settings.
  • Jacquemus schedules boutique preorders for Sunday, an online drop on jacquemus.com on Sept. 29, and a wider release via Nike SNKRS and select retailers on Oct. 6.
  • A Paris flagship event is planned for Sunday at 11 a.m., where Simon Porte Jacquemus, Chavez, and Pearch will sign a campaign fanzine.
  • The reinterpretation nods to Bill Bowerman’s 1972 Moon Shoe with a ruched nylon upper, elasticized back, and Nike Regrind outsole.
  • The shoe will come in Off Noir, University Red, and a Jacquemus-exclusive Alabaster, with The Mirror reporting a £165 price that has not been confirmed by the brands.
